Postpartum Services

  • On-call 2 weeks before & after EDD excluding blackout dates

  • Breast/chest/bottle-feeding education & guidance

  • Introductory newborn sleep principles/concepts

  • Infant bathing

  • Diaper changing

  • Cord care

  • Circumcision care

  • Soothing & swaddle techniques

  • Day time and/or overnight support (subject to availability)

  • Baby laundry

  • Nursery organization

  • Light house cleaning

  • Meal prep: postpartum nutrition

  • Baby-wearing education

  • Pump/bottle sterilization

  • Accompany clients to doctor visits

  • Run errands

Doula does not:

  • Diagnose medical conditions

  • Perform clinical tasks

  • Take over the care of the newborn. A parent or family member must be home

  • Drive clients

  • Walks dogs

  • Heavy house cleaning tasks

  • Advance cash
